          What Is a Rooftop Unit, and When Does It Make Sense?
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Rooftop units suit single-story buildings with flat roofs. An RTU houses the compressor, condenser, evaporator, and air handler in one rooftop cabinet, freeing ground-level space, a plus for retail plazas.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          RTUs suit large open-floor spaces like warehouses in Steeles West or Edgeley, single-tenant retail and restaurants with simple air distribution, and buildings over 2,000 square feet needing only one or two cooling zones.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          One important consideration: the City's Building Standards Department requires a permit for any new or altered commercial AC installation. RTU projects may also require a site plan agreement review under the Planning Act before a permit application can proceed, and drawings must be prepared by a BCIN-qualified designer. Budget extra lead time for this process.

          When Does a Split System Outperform a Rooftop Unit?
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Split systems offer zone-level flexibility RTUs often can't match. They separate the outdoor condensing unit from the indoor air handler, linked by refrigerant lines. This suits multi-tenant offices near the VMC or Vaughan Mills, where tenants need independent temperature control without shared ductwork, and it keeps interiors quieter since noisy components stay outside.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Split systems may fit better for multi-room medical offices or suites needing individual zone control, older Woodbridge buildings whose roofs can't support an RTU without costly reinforcement, and storefronts under 1,500 square feet where an RTU's crane cost isn't justified.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          On cost, RTU installations for mid-size commercial spaces typically range from roughly $8,000 to $20,000 CAD depending on tonnage, crane logistics, and ductwork, while split system projects can run $5,000 to $15,000 for comparable square footage. Always get written quotes for commercial AC installation, as labor costs in the GTA continue to climb.

          Do I Need a Permit for a Commercial HVAC Installation in Vaughan, ON?
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Yes. The City of Vaughan requires a permit for any new or altered commercial HVAC installation. Apply through the city's online portal; drawings must come from a BCIN-qualified designer, and some projects may need a site plan letter of undertaking first.

          Which System Lasts Longer: RTU or Split?
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Both systems can last 15 to 20 years with proper maintenance. Split systems have more refrigerant line connections, meaning more potential leak points over time. Bi-annual inspections are recommended for rooftop units in the GTA, since UV exposure and Ontario's seasonal swings degrade coil fins and economizer dampers faster than ground-level equipment.

          Can a Vaughan, ON, Commercial Building Use Both System Types?
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Yes. Larger properties often use RTUs for main floor space and mini-splits for smaller offices or server rooms needing tighter control. A qualified contractor can assess your layout and recommend a hybrid strategy where it fits.
